The vacuum forming process involves heating a flat plastic sheet until it becomes pliable. The heated sheet is then placed over a mold and a vacuum is applied to draw the sheet tightly against the mold’s surface. The plastic cools and hardens, taking on the shape of the mold. Once the formed plastic product is removed from the mold, it is trimmed and finished to create the final product.

Another advantage of vacuum forming is its cost-effective nature. Compared to other manufacturing methods such as injection molding, vacuum forming is relatively inexpensive. The molds used in vacuum forming are typically made of aluminum or composite materials, which are more affordable than steel molds used in injection molding. This makes vacuum forming a cost-effective option for producing custom plastic products in small to medium quantities.

In the packaging industry, vacuum formed trays and clamshells are commonly used to package and protect consumer goods. These custom-made packaging solutions provide a secure and attractive way to showcase products while ensuring they remain safe during transport and storage.

In the automotive industry, vacuum forming is used to produce a variety of components such as interior trim panels, dashboard covers, and engine parts. The ability of vacuum forming to create complex shapes and designs makes it an ideal choice for producing custom automotive parts that meet the specific requirements of manufacturers.

In the medical industry, vacuum forming is used to create custom medical device packaging, surgical trays, and equipment enclosures. The precise molding capabilities of vacuum forming ensure that medical products are safely housed and protected, meeting strict regulatory standards for hygiene and safety.
